Key Responsibilities
• Manage the end-to-end accounts receivable cycle, including invoicing, collections, and tracking outstanding balances
• Monitor aging reports and follow up with clients to ensure timely payments
• Reconcile customer accounts and resolve discrepancies in coordination with internal teams
• Support cost analysis and cost control initiatives to improve financial efficiency
• Assist in budgeting and forecasting processes, including preparation of cost sheets and variance analysis
• Contribute to financial insights and reporting to support decision-making
• Assist in maintaining books of accounts and ensure accuracy in financial records
• Support month-end and year-end closing activities
• Ensure compliance with accounting standards and internal financial processes
